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"diversified environment" is a correct and usable phrase in written English.
You can use it to refer to a situation or an area that has a variety of components that create a diverse atmosphere. For example, "Her classroom was a diversified environment that welcomed students from different backgrounds and cultures."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When describing a situation with a wide range of elements, use "diversified environment" to emphasize the heterogeneity and variety present.
Common error
Avoid using "diversified environment" when simply referring to a large environment; ensure that the environment actually exhibits significant variety or diversity in its components or characteristics.

FAQs
How can I use "diversified environment" in a sentence?
You can use "diversified environment" to describe settings with a wide array of elements. For instance, "The university offers a "diverse environment" for learning and growth".
What's a good alternative to "diversified environment"?
Alternatives include "varied atmosphere", "complex environment", or "heterogeneous milieu", dep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.
Is it better to say "diverse environment" or "diversified environment"?
Both "diverse environment" and "diversified environment" are grammatically correct; however, "diverse environment" is generally more common. "Diversified environment" implies a deliberate effort to create diversity.
In what contexts is "diversified environment" most appropriate?
"Diversified environment" is suitable in contexts where you want to emphasize the variety and heterogeneity of a setting, such as describing a workplace, educational institution, or ecosystem.
